Santa Company: The Secret of Christmas dives into a whimsical world where the magic of Christmas is both enchanting and a bit chaotic. Directed by Kenji Itoso, this feature expands on the original short, layering in more depth and a richer narrative. The animation is charming, with a soft palette that captures the warmth of the holiday spirit. The pacing feels relaxed, allowing the viewer to soak in the atmosphere and the charming characters without feeling rushed. Themes of friendship, believing in magic, and the spirit of giving are woven throughout, giving it a heartwarming core. It’s interesting to see how this film builds on its predecessor, offering a fresh perspective while still holding onto that delightful anime vibe.
Follow-up to the 2014 short film.Features a blend of whimsical animation and heartfelt storytelling.Explores themes of friendship and magic during the holiday season.
